"We're talking about a few more weeks, weeks rather than months I hope".He continued:
"To be blunt and honest with people, the restrictions that are in place are not going to be lifted tomorrow, we're going to have to keep at it".Speaking to PJ and Jim on Classic Hits this morning, Mr Harris said that it's about showing Irish people what the journey towards beating the Covid-19 virus looks like. Although there may be no "magic point" at which the virus is 100 percent gone, people will be able to see each other. He said that if we keep at the current level of measures for another couple of weeks, it's about seeing where that brings us. He was also keen to warn people that "the virus is probably going to be here for a very long time" but it's about ensuring that our health service can keep it under control.
